Description
½ Ducato from Kingdom of Naples. Issued from 1554 to 1556. Struck in Silver. Measures 34 mm and weighs 14.95 g.
- Obverse
- King Philip II with bare or crowned head, facing right. Designer mark behind head.
- Reverse
- Crowned shield of manifold arms in oval baroque frame.
- Edge
- Smooth
